Hi guys,

I've installed iAtkos S3 V2 on my Asus 1050PN with those options:

 

------------------------------

Bootloader

- Chameleon v2 RC5

 

Bootloader Options

- Graphics Enabler

- Ethernet

 

Patches

- /Extra directory

- Fakesmc

- Disabler

- Modified Kernels -> Atom Kernel

 

Drivers

- Main Hardware -> SATA/IDE -> AHCI SATA

- Sound -> Voodoo HDA

- PS/2 -> VoodooPS/2

- Laptop Hardware -> Battery

 

VGA

- Intel -> GMA X3100

------------------------------

 

Then I copyed a patched DSDT.aml in /Extra

 

Put a PS2 kexts fix in Extra/Extensions:

- AppleACPIPS2Nub.kext

- VoodooPS2Controller.kext

 

and finally install an ETH fix with Kext Helper:

- AtherosL1cEthernet.kext

 

- Full maintenance with Kext Helper (Permissions, mkext, chache)

- reboot

 

------------------------------

 

Every thinks works fine so I decided to upgrade to 10.6.8 combo:

 

- replaced the mach_kernel

- installed the combo pkg

- restore AppleACPIPlatform and IOPCIFamily kexts from 10.6.7 version

- reboot

 

Now I've got my system up and running but all the USB devices, except fot the keyboard and touchpad, is not working. :(

 

Can you please help me to fix the USB problem?
